Saitama Chichibu confirmed wild boar swine cholera infection First September 25th Kanto 7:54

Wild boar was found dead in Chichibu City, Saitama Prefecture. As a result of the inspection, infection to swine cholera was confirmed. It is the first time in the Kanto region that wild boars have been confirmed to be infected, and the prefecture requires pig farms to thoroughly disinfect them.

This month, Saitama Prefecture was confirmed to be infected with swine cholera one after another at the pig farms in Chichibu City and the neighboring Ogano Town.

Under such circumstances, on the afternoon of this month, a female wild boar with a length of about 1 meter was found in Chichibu City's residential site.

The wild boar died and was examined by a national institution. On the 24th, infection with swine cholera was confirmed.

It is the first time in the Kanto region that swine cholera infection has been confirmed in wild boars.

The wild boar was found about 3 kilometers north of the pig farm in Chichibu City, where infection with swine fever was confirmed on the 13th of this month.

In addition to investigating the route of infection, the prefecture continues to investigate whether wild boar is captured in the surrounding forests and whether the infection has spread.
